Публикации по теме 'anonymous-function'


JavaScript — Анонимные функции, Стрелочная функция | JavaScript 09.
Концепции JavaScript Упрощение кода с помощью анонимных и стрелочных функций в #JavaScript Функция, которую нельзя назвать. Анонимная функция в JavaScript — это функция без имени. (function () { console.log("This is a anonymous function."); })(); //It has executed immediate execution Output:- This is a anonymous function. Синтаксис функции должен быть заключен в фигурные скобки (). Мы не можем выбрать выполнение там, где это определено. Мы можем сохранить..

Функции в JavaScript
Функция JavaScript - это блок кода, предназначенный для выполнения определенной задачи. И выполняется только при вызове / вызове. Есть много способов создания функций в javascript: 1. Оператор функции или объявление функции function add(a,b){ return a+b; } var ans = add(2,2); console.log(ans); //Output: 4 2. Функциональное выражение var add = function(a,b){ return a+b; } var ans = add(2,2); console.log(ans); //Output: 4 Вы заметили какую-либо разницу в двух приведенных..

Вопросы по теме 'anonymous-function'

Эквивалент анонимных методов C # в Java?
В C # вы можете определять делегатов анонимно (даже если они не более чем синтаксический сахар). Например, я могу это сделать: public string DoSomething(Func<string, string> someDelegate) { // Do something involving someDelegate(string...
23482 просмотров

Низкая производительность при использовании анонимных функций в MATLAB. Заметили ли это другие?
Чтобы реорганизовать мой код MATLAB, я подумал, что буду передавать функции в качестве аргументов (то, что MATLAB называет анонимными функциями), вдохновленный функциональным программированием. Однако, похоже, производительность сильно пострадала....
5927 просмотров
schedule 04.03.2022

Как создать пустую анонимную функцию в MATLAB?
Я использую анонимные функции для диагностической печати при отладке в MATLAB. Например., debug_disp = @(str) disp(str); debug_disp('Something is up.') ... debug_disp = @(str) disp([]); % diagnostics are now hidden Использование disp([]) в...
9709 просмотров
schedule 21.02.2024

Установка области действия анонимной функции «это» в утилите jQuery/методах ajax
Как указано в этой записи в блоге , вы можете установить область действия this в анонимной функции. в Javascript. Есть ли более элегантный способ определения области this в вызове анонимной функции success запроса AJAX (т.е. без...
3530 просмотров

Почему обратный вызов Params::Validate не работает для ссылки на анонимную функцию?
Я использую Params::Validate для проверки, но в разделе обратных вызовов вместо определяя прямую анонимную функцию, если я попытаюсь дать ссылку на эту анонимную функцию, она сразу перейдет в область регистрации ошибок без печати сообщения внутри...
283 просмотров
schedule 05.02.2023

JavaScript: при назначении анонимной функции переменной возвращаемое значение функции не передается, а передается функция в виде строки
Я пытаюсь изучить JavaScript, но столкнулся с препятствием. Если ответ очевиден и доступен через простой поиск, заранее извиняюсь. Я новичок в программировании и JavaScript и не знаю, какой линии исследования следовать. В следующем коде функция...
14859 просмотров
schedule 13.02.2023

Вопрос об области анонимных функций PHP
Я пытаюсь отсортировать массив объектов по общему свойству, однако мне не удается зарегистрировать параметр $ property во внутренней функции (я могу использовать его во внешней функции, ОК). Как я читал документацию, это звучало так, как будто...
1607 просмотров
schedule 07.11.2022

Как я могу написать анонимную функцию на Java?
Это вообще возможно?
129243 просмотров
schedule 21.09.2022

Аргументы анонимной функции JavaScript
for (var i = 0; i < somearray.length; i++) { myclass.foo({'arg1':somearray[i][0]}, function() { console.log(somearray[i][0]); }); } Как передать массив или один из его индексов в анонимную функцию? somearray уже находится...
7272 просмотров

Каков тип лямбда-функции?
В С++ 0x мне интересно, какой тип лямбда-функции. Конкретно: #include<iostream> type1 foo(int x){ return [x](int y)->int{return x * y;}; } int main(){ std::cout<<foo(3)(4);//would output 12 type2 bar = foo(5);...
2476 просмотров

Слушатели ExtJS: анонимные параметры функции
Я взял этот код из какой-то книги, которую наткнулся в Интернете... sm: new Ext.grid.RowSelectionModel({ singleSelect: true, listeners: { rowselect: { fn: function(sm,index,record) { Ext.Msg.alert('You...
6323 просмотров

Как передать анонимные подпрограммы при вызове подпрограммы Perl?
mysub получает ссылку на подпрограмму в качестве первого аргумента. Могу я просто позвонить mysub(sub{some subroutine body here}) ? т.е. определить анонимную подпрограмму прямо при вызове? В порядке ли синтаксис (действительно ли...
2695 просмотров
schedule 16.06.2022

Преобразование анонимной функции PHP в неанонимную
Я задал связанный вопрос, прежде чем потерял свой идентификатор входа в систему - PHP Version 5.2.14 / Ошибка синтаксического анализа: синтаксическая ошибка, неожиданная T_FUNCTION, ожидание ')' - но это "целая" проблема. Мне трудно понять, как...
559 просмотров
schedule 18.06.2023

Есть ли разница между (function () {} ()); и (function () {}) () ;?
Возможный дубликат: Местоположение скобок для автоматического выполнения анонимных функций JavaScript? Иногда вижу: (function() { ... }()); и иногда вижу: (function() { ... })(); Я вижу обе формы с аргументами и...
3936 просмотров
schedule 30.05.2022

Ruby: Могут ли параметры лямбда-функции иметь значения по умолчанию?
Я хочу сделать что-то похожее на это: def creator() return lambda { |arg1, arg2 = nil| puts arg1 if(arg2 != nil) puts arg2 end } end test = creator()...
14169 просмотров

Ссылки на анонимные функции в Javascript
В настоящее время я занимаюсь созданием ОЧЕНЬ простого класса Observer для проекта, над которым я работаю. Я успешно реализовал методы подписки, отписки и уведомления. Все работает точно так, как ожидалось, при использовании обычных функций...
2521 просмотров

Замыкание и анонимная функция (разница?)
Возможные дубликаты: Что такое Closures / Lambda в PHP или Javascript с точки зрения непрофессионала? В чем разница между 'закрытием' и 'лямбдой'? Hi, Мне не удалось найти определение, которое четко объясняет различия между...
25652 просмотров
schedule 12.02.2023

Закрытие PHP для члена класса после создания экземпляра дает неопределенный метод
Я пытаюсь взломать ACL в шаблоне, не сообщая шаблону об объекте ACL в определении класса. Следующий код генерирует неопределенный метод Template::isAllowed Почему это? ТИА! class ACL { protected $allowed =...
395 просмотров
schedule 29.10.2023

ParallelCurl с CURLOPT_WRITEFUNCTION
Я пытаюсь использовать ParallelCurl с обратный вызов, когда cURL получает данные с сервера , к которому он подключен. Вот код, который у меня сейчас есть: function request_finished($content, $url, $ch, $user_data) { echo "Request Finished:...
1753 просмотров
schedule 07.03.2024

Javascript: закрытие цикла?
Я хотел бы сделать следующее: for (var i = 0; i < 10; ++i) { createButton(x, y, function() { alert("button " + i + " pressed"); } } Проблема в том, что я всегда получаю окончательное значение i , потому что закрытие Javascript не по...
880 просмотров
schedule 02.02.2023